Defined in 2 files as a macro:
- arch/microblaze/include/asm/current.h, line 26 (as a macro)
- include/asm-generic/current.h, line 7 (as a macro)
Defined in 6 files as a function:
- arch/arm64/include/asm/current.h, line 15 (as a function)
- arch/m68k/include/asm/current.h, line 20 (as a function)
- arch/powerpc/include/asm/current.h, line 15 (as a function)
- arch/riscv/include/asm/current.h, line 27 (as a function)
- arch/x86/include/asm/current.h, line 13 (as a function)
- arch/xtensa/include/asm/current.h, line 22 (as a function)
Referenced in 11 files:
- arch/arm64/include/asm/current.h, line 24
- arch/m68k/include/asm/current.h, line 25
- arch/m68k/include/asm/entry.h
- arch/powerpc/include/asm/current.h, line 26
- arch/riscv/include/asm/current.h, line 33
- arch/sh/kernel/process_64.c, line 280
- arch/um/kernel/time.c
- arch/x86/include/asm/current.h, line 18
- arch/xtensa/include/asm/current.h, line 27
- arch/xtensa/mm/tlb.c, line 169
- include/asm-generic/current.h, line 8